If you have already decided that you want to buy a new soundbar, but still don’t know what exactly you want, the Sony HT-G700 vs Yamaha SR-B20A comparison is here to offer you two decent solutions. The Sony HT-G700 was rated 6.2, while the Yamaha SR-B20A has a rating 3.8. The soundbars are equipped with a different number of buttons, power, volume down, volume up, input, Bluetooth for the HT-G700 and power, source, demo, volume down, volume up for the SR-B20A.

Audio features

Each of the models under consideration has active amplification type. A noticeable difference is the number of channels that HT-G700 has 3.1 and SR-B20A has 2.1. These rivals can be compared in terms of power, 400 (overall) versus 100 (overall) according to devices. A built-in subwoofer is available only in the Yamaha SR-B20A. Rate 7 out of 10 received the Sony HT-G700 for audio features and specs, but the Yamaha SR-B20A received 5 out of 10.

Streaming services

Soundbars do not have AirPlay support. The units in this comparison do not support Spotify.

Connectivity

Both models do not have a wireless Wi-Fi interface. Soundbars from this comparison have Bluetooth support. There are 1/1 HDMI inputs/outputs in the Sony HT-G700 versus 0/1 HDMIs in the Yamaha SR-B20A. As in the HT-G700, so in the SR-B20A there is the HDMI Audio Return Channel (ARC). Connecting devices via USB is possible in both models. We rated the connectivity of the HT-G700 at 8 out of 10, while the SR-B20A was rated 4/10.

Features

None of these soundbars can be controlled using the app. Soundbars in this review are not equipped with a microphone. The models under consideration cannot become part of a multiroom system.

Multichannel surround

Dolby Atmos audio decoder is onboard the HT-G700. The HT-G700 can work with surround sound due to DTS:X support. The HT-G700 was rated 10/10, while the SR-B20A received a mark of 6/10 for multichannel surround.
